The final bill for fixing a sliding door usually depends on a few key things. We look at the extent of track damage, whether the rollers are jammed or worn out, and if the glass panel needs a seal adjustment or a full replacement. Hardware quality and the specific make of your door also play a role in the total. While simple adjustments might be on the lower end, more intensive parts replacement can increase the labor time required.
Over time, sliding door tracks can become dented, clogged with debris, or bent, causing the door to jump or drag. Repairing a track involves cleaning out the channel, hammering out minor dents, or installing a stainless steel track cover to create a smooth surface for the rollers. A smooth-sliding door usually comes down to clean, functional rollers and an unobstructed track. If your door is sticking, the rollers might need cleaning, lubrication, or replacement. Yes, replacing rollers is a very common repair for sliding glass doors. Worn-out rollers are frequently the cause of doors that are difficult to open or close. The specialists can easily replace these parts. This is a standard fix that restores smooth movement to your door in Dallas.
To get a sliding glass door back on track, it typically involves lifting the door and carefully guiding the rollers back into the track. Sometimes, adjustments are needed to ensure it stays on.
